Larry Beemer was a Beaverdam HS graduate

Larry Lynn Beemer, 77, died March 2, 2020, at his residence. Larry was born July 24, 1942, in Beaverdam to the late Roy and Florence (Walters) Beemer.  On March 19, 1980, he married Carolyn (Taylor) Beemer who survives.

Larry graduated from Beaverdam High School and then served in the United States Army. He retired from Airfoil Textron in Lima and then worked at Greto Trucking in Lima.

Bluffton HS orchestra "excellent" at state competition

The Bluffton HS string orchestra received an excellent rating at OMEA state orchestra adjudicated event held on Friday, Feb. 28 at Whitmer HS in Toledo. 

The orchestra performed ‘A Renaissance Fair’ arranged by Ann McGinty, ‘Midnight Rain’ by Susan Day and ‘Danse Infernale’ by Elliot del Borgo.

The 24-member orchestra is under the direction of Rachael E. Lewis and assisted by Debb Herr.

Student Art Launch Party and Showcase at Bluffton Public Library

In honor of Student Art Month, this year’s Student Art Showcase begins with a Launch Party on Thursday, March 5 at 6 p.m.!
Join us for refreshments and check out the creative work from our young community! Students’ artwork will then be on display for the rest of the month. Art teachers from area schools have made art selections for their students and submitted them for this event. A selection of homeschool student art will also be included, as submitted by parents.

"Prohibition" theme of March 9 history talk at Maple Crest

Monthly program sponsored by Bluffton Senior Citizens

The March Bluffton Senior Citizens Association history talk theme is “Prohibition.”

The program takes place at Maple Crest Senior Living Village, 700 Maple Crest Court, at 2 p.m., Monday, March 9, and is free and open to the public. 

The program is presented by the speakers’ bureau of the Hancock Historical Museum, 422 W. Sandusky St., Findlay.
